Exit window installation services involve the process of fitting specialized windows into existing wall openings, typically designed to serve as emergency exits or egress points. These installations require precise measurements and fitting to ensure the window functions correctly and meets safety standards. Service providers may also handle the removal of old or damaged windows and prepare the opening to accommodate the new unit, ensuring a secure and proper fit that enhances the property's safety and accessibility.

This service addresses common problems such as outdated, damaged, or non-compliant windows that can compromise safety during emergencies. Installing an appropriate exit window helps ensure clear and reliable egress routes in case of fire or other emergencies, potentially facilitating quicker evacuation. Additionally, proper installation can improve the property's overall safety features, prevent drafts or leaks, and contribute to better energy efficiency by sealing the opening correctly.

Properties that typically utilize exit window installation services include residential homes, especially those with basements or rooms designated as bedrooms, where egress windows are often required by building codes. Commercial buildings, such as office spaces or multi-unit residential complexes, also frequently need these windows to meet safety regulations. In some cases, renovation projects or property upgrades may necessitate replacing existing windows with newer, code-compliant exit windows to enhance safety and compliance.

Cost of Exit Window Installation - The typical cost range for installing an exit window varies from approximately $1,200 to $3,500, depending on factors like window size and complexity. Larger or custom-sized windows tend to increase the overall expense.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.

Labor Charges for Exit Window Setup - Labor costs for installation services generally fall between $500 and $1,500, influenced by the project's scope and accessibility. More intricate installations or those requiring additional structural work may push costs higher. Contact local service providers for precise labor estimates.

Material Expenses for Exit Windows - The price for the window itself often ranges from $300 to $1,200, with higher-end or specialized models costing more. The choice of materials, such as vinyl or aluminum frames, also impacts the overall material costs. Local suppliers can help identify options within different budget ranges.

Additional Costs to Consider - Additional expenses, such as permits, structural modifications, or finishing work, can add between $200 and $800 to the total. These costs vary based on local building codes and the specific installation site. Pros can advise on potential extra charges for comprehensive project planning.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is an exit window? An exit window is a window designed to provide egress in case of emergency, often required in basements or bedrooms for safety compliance.

Are there size requirements for exit windows? Yes, local building codes typically specify minimum size and opening dimensions to ensure safe egress during emergencies.

Can existing windows be converted into exit windows? In some cases, existing windows can be modified to meet exit requirements, but it depends on the current window’s size and structure.

What types of windows are suitable for installation as exit windows? Common options include casement, awning, or sliding windows that can be easily opened wide enough for safe egress.
